Actress Lee Si Young gave birth to her second child, a baby girl, months after her divorce, and her choice of a high-end postpartum care center has become a major talking point in Korea.

On Nov. 5, Lee shared several photos on her social media account, announcing the birth with an emotional caption: “I believe this child is a gift from God. I will make sure Jungyoon and Siksiki are happy forever. I am deeply grateful to Professor Won Hyesung and will never forget this gratitude.”

Accompanying photos showed Lee holding her newborn daughter in the hospital, as well as a touching photo of her first child, Jungyoon, looking proud and kind like a new big brother.

She also posted a photo of her baby’s tiny hand holding hers, captioned “Hello, my little angel.”

Lee Si Young married a restaurant entrepreneur nine years her senior in 2017 and gave birth to her first child the following year. However, after eight years of marriage, the couple officially divorced in March 2025.

Following the separation, controversy erupted when it was revealed that Lee had proceeded to implant a frozen embryo created during her marriage, without her ex-husband’s consent. At the time, the five-year limit on embryo storage was about to expire, leading Lee to decide between disposal or implantation.

Despite divided public reaction, Lee’s agency clarified that no illegal procedures were involved, and her ex-husband later stated that he would fulfill his responsibilities as a father to their second child.

After stabilizing her pregnancy, Lee shared positive updates over the summer, including a trip to the United States with her son and the announcement that she was expecting a baby girl named “Siksiki.”

On November 5, a representative of The axle factory confirmed to OSEN: “Actress Lee Si Young recently gave birth to a healthy baby girl. Both mother and baby are resting and recovering well. She plans to resume activities once she fully regains her health.”

Fans also noticed Lee’s surroundings in the photos, which appeared to be taken at a luxury postpartum care center in Seoul’s Yeoksam-dong district. The named structure D Postpartum Care Center it is often described as Korea’s most expensive, with private gardens, art gallery-style interiors, and hotel-level amenities.

According to reports, the center’s rates range from â‚©12 million for two weeks to over â‚©50 million for the most exclusive suite options. Numerous celebrity couples have reportedly stayed at the same facility after giving birth, including Hyun Bin and son Ye-jin, Lee Byung-hun and Lee Min-jung, Ji Sung and Lee Bo-young, Kwon Sang-woo and son Tae-youngAND Taeyang and Min Hyo-rin.

While some netizens continue to debate the ethical issues surrounding her post-divorce pregnancy, many have expressed admiration for Lee’s strength as a single mother and her commitment to her family.

Her touching posts, combined with her honesty and resilience, led fans to flood her comments section with congratulations and well wishes for both her and her newborn daughter.
